“Mal!” Inara said anxiously into the ‘com. “Mal, listen. River’s having one of her feelings – she says you’ve all got to get out, now. Something about it not being what you think. Mal, are you receiving this?”

“Mal ain’t linked up, ‘Nara.” Zoe apparently was. Even under the signal’s distortion, her voice sounded strange: kind of rattled. “He’s takin’ a call.”

“A call? From whom?”

“Niska.”

Niska ? Adelai Niska?” Inara exclaimed. Shaken, she stared at River, who was still gripping her head and keening softly. “ Run-tse duh fwo-tzoo ching bao-yo wuomun … that explains it. What’s going on?”

“Beats me,” came the reply. That was Jayne, with thunder in his voice. “Find out soon enough, I guess.”

There was a clattering in the hallway and then Simon was there in the cockpit with them – arms encircling his sister’s shoulders, asking her to look at him, asking her what was the matter. He seemed almost more stricken than she.

River met his worried gaze. “Someone’s been here before,” she said, nibbling on her lower lip. “Not real people – spiders. We’re flies, stuck in a web.”

Seconds later, an unexpected sound reached their ears. The distant whirring of a closing airlock door.
